Auto-translated to English by AII live in the Appartementen Van Kralingen, right in the heart of Kralingen on Lusthofstraat. The traditional shopping street of Kralingen. Here you'll find the best butcher Van Linschoten, a real greengrocer Vreugdenhil, proper bakers, a Rotterdam cheese shop De Amstelhoeve, liquor store Den Toom. And a very nice crowd living in this neighbourhood, from young to old and from all over. There are many foreign students studying at Erasmus University. In short: Rotterdam at its best!

About Siondwarsstraat 64, Rotterdam
The asking price is 15% below the average asking price in Kralingen West (€469,833) and close to the median of €400,000. Given the efficient energy label A and modern build year of 1990, it's priced keenly compared to other apartments in the neighbourhood.
Kralingen West scores 8.9 out of 10 from residents. It's described as quiet, clean and green, with plenty of facilities. The area has a high density of 5,779 addresses per km², making it very urban, yet the Kralingse Plas park is just 300 metres away for green space.
Albert Heijn and Aldi are both just 69 metres away, so you can do your daily shopping in a minute's walk. Ekoplaza and SPAR are 137 metres away, giving you several options within a couple of streets.
De Bavokring primary school is 177 metres away, a two-minute walk. For secondary education, the Vrije School Zuid-Holland is also at 177 metres, and the Libanon Lyceum is 334 metres away. Several other schools are within a ten-minute walk.
The nearest train station is 1.7 km away, about a 20-minute walk or a short cycle. This connects you to the wider Rotterdam area and beyond.
The apartment has energy label A, which is very efficient. This means lower heating costs and a smaller environmental footprint compared to older homes. In Kralingen West, only 20.5% of homes have label A, so this is a strong point.
Residents give mixed feedback: one says it's 'clean and full of greenery' but adds 'sometimes unsafe'. Another says 'no problems'. The total number of crimes in the neighbourhood is 875, but without context, it's best to visit and get a feel for the street yourself.
There are currently 81 apartments for sale in the neighbourhood, with prices ranging from €230,000 to €1,365,000. The average floor area is 89 m², so this 74 m² apartment is slightly smaller but priced below average per m².
